Night shift — reminder we share Lab 3 with the Merrow Optics team until Friday. Their laser rig is mid-calibration; do not move the bench covers or unplug anything on the north wall. Log all entries carefully, and wipe down shared surfaces before handover. The side door now needs the updated pass code below.

door code, bawif-hawef: bdg-HMTCP-8

Changelog — Pictave v3.2, EXIF scrubbing. Quick note for support: we renamed SCRUB_MODE to EXIF_SCRUB_POLICY, since folks kept guessing what it did. Values are the same (strip, preserve-orientation, off). If a customer's self-hosted instance stops scrubbing uploads after upgrading, their env file probably still has the old name. Have them rename it, then confirm the next line sets the scrubber's signing secret.

env line for fafof-fahag: LEDGER_TOKEN5=f8790

Subject: DR Drill — Friday, Dependency Pinning Scope

Welcome aboard, Priya. During Friday's disaster-recovery drill for the Kestrelline build farm, we'll rebuild from pinned manifests only — no floating versions, per the Tamber policy doc. Please verify each lockfile hash before restoring. If the sealed restore node prompts you, enter the passphrase exactly as provided on the line below.

vault phrase of tajeg-tageg = pelix-druix-holius-briael-zorwyn-frawyn-fraox-norok-drueth-aldiel

## Deploying the Gatewick Proctor Queue

Deploys are pretty painless: push to main, wait for the pipeline, then watch the queue drain dashboard for five minutes. If candidates pile up mid-exam, roll back first and ask questions later — the queue replays safely. Everything the workers care about lives in one config block, shown here for reference.

settings of bafof-yagef:
JOROX_PIN=8740
JOROX_TENANT=pelox
JOROX_METRICS_HOST=metrics.jorox.qorvelworks.internal
JOROX_SEAL=seal_c78f63c1
JOROX_STANDBY_TEAM=norax

Deploy step 4 — FareTrial pricing experiment. Reviewer: confirm the experiment flags in the env file match the approved variant list before merging. Bucket ratios are set by PRICE_SPLIT and must sum to 100. After the flags, add the single credential line that lets the pricing service read the experiment assignment store; it belongs right here:

vault entry, bagep-yahip: VAULT_KEY8=d2a227e5